Peptide ligands for a sugar-binding protein isolated from a random peptide library.

Peptide ligands for the carbohydrate-binding protein concanavalin A (Con A) have been identified by screening a large, diverse peptide library expressed on the surface of filamentous phage. A dodecapeptide containing the consensus sequence Tyr-Pro-Tyr was found to bind Con A with an affinity (dissociation constant, Kd) of 46 microM, comparable to that of a known carbohydrate ligand, methyl alpha-D-mannopyranoside (Kd of 89 microM). In addition the peptide inhibited precipitation of the alpha-glucan dextran 1355 by Con A. Given the complexity of oligosaccharide synthesis, the prospect of finding peptides that competitively inhibit carbohydrate-specific receptors may simplify the development of new therapeutic agents.
